It’s been a long time that I’m anticipating to start reading Abercrobie’s books, because they sound very appealing to me. To my surprise I didn’t find it dark nor grim as I thought, there’s lots of good humor and the atmosphere is relatively “calm” without any imminent cataclysm, or a world in the brink of total destruction. The world changes, but it looks like that it would take some time until we’ll witness dramatic changes in the world. As I see it, it’s more *light* fantasy than dark fantasy ...more

The start of the best fantasy series I've read in years. Brutal, gritty, and unflinching; reminds me of Glen Cook's Black Company books, although I think I prefer this trilogy overall. That's high praise. ...more
